Chișinău International Airport to restrict access due to Hasidic pilgrim influx
Chișinău International Airport (Eugen Doga) will implement special access restrictions from September 14 to 17, 2026. These measures are being introduced to manage an increased flow of passengers consisting of Hasidic pilgrims.
According to the airport administration and the Risk Management Group of the Civil Aviation Authority, terminal access during this period will be limited to passengers, airport staff, and flight crews. Passengers are permitted to enter the terminal no more than three hours before their scheduled departure and must present travel documents and flight confirmation.
To maintain order and safety, bus traffic will be strictly organized. Drivers and group organizers must use designated parking and movement zones as instructed by airport personnel and authorities. The measures are being enforced through a coordinated effort involving the Border Police, Customs Service, General Inspectorate of Carabinieri, National Public Security Inspectorate, and the National Agency for Food Safety.
